Paris Saint-Germain forward Neymar is reportedly set to open legal proceedings as he looks to force a move back to Barcelona.

The Brazilian was heavily linked with a move to the Catalan giants last summer but a deal failed to materialise and he subsequently had to stay with the French club who bought him in 2017.

Sport now reports that Neymar has instructed his legal team to investigate potential exit routes from the club that would allow him to move back to Barcelona in the summer.

The former Santos man will reach the end of his 'protected period' with PSG at the end of this season, enabling him to open talks with other clubs as he is effectively in a position to buy himself out of his current contract.

Since making the switch to the Parc des Prince, Neymar has scored 60 goals in 70 appearances across all competitions for the Parisians.
